In today’s paper, there’s a short piece about Beth Schott, Westlake Village’s City Clerk. Beth has just been recognized for 25 years of service to the city as the City does for its employee milestones (such as a 25 year anniversary). But, the article has an error: she is not retiring. “I’m honored by the City’s recognition of my 25 year milestone,” Ms. Schott said. “and I have no plans at the present time to retire.”
